Mr Edgar Lenski

 

Edgar Lenski Federal Chancellery Germany

Edgar Lenski teaches the courses European Law I - Basics of European (constitutiona) Law and European Law II - Internal Market with Ingolf Pernice in the first year in the Executive Master in EU Studies.

He studied German, French, European and International Law at the Universities of Trier, Maastricht and Berlin (Humboldt University of Berlin). From 2000 to 2002 he worked as a researcher at the Walter Hallstein-Institute for European Constitutional Law at Humboldt University of Berlin (chair Prof. Pernice). Since 2002 he is lecturer at the law faculty of Humboldt University of Berlin and at the German-Polish Law School (Humboldt University and Uniwersytet Wroclawski). Edgar Lenski teaches since 2002 as a Visiting Lecturer at the University of Wales, Aberystwyth. 

From 2006 - 2014 he worked as a Legal Officer with the EU Law Unit of the Federal Ministry of Economics. From 2015 to 2022, he worked in the European Policy DG of the Federal Chancellery of Germany. Since 2022, Edgar Lenski is Head of Group 51 (“General EU Affairs, Relations with EU Member States, EU External Relations”) in the Federal Chancellery of Germany. This includes i.a. the conference on the future of Europe, EU law and enlargement policy. Additionally he is a permanent research fellow at the Walter Hallstein-Institute for European Constitutional Law at Humboldt University of Berlin.

Edgar Lenski lectures within the blended-learning programme jointly with Ingolf Pernice on European Constitutional Law and on substantive law of European Union since 2004.
